Architectural Marvel: Municipal Theatre of Seinajoki
Located in Seinäjoki, Finland, the Municipal Theatre of Seinajoki impresses with its unique architectural design by Alvar Aalto, though construction was completed in the 1980s under Elissa Aalto's supervision.
This theatre is not only a cultural hub but also features an engaging foyer showcasing design pieces from Aalto's company, Artek, including distinctive bentwood reliefs. Its foundation in the 1960s marks a significant development in Finnish cultural life.
